  • Title

    An Electronic Voltage and Frequency Controller for Single-Phase Self-Excited Induction Generators for Pico Hydro Applications

  • Abstract
    This paper presents the design, implementation and control of an electronic load controller (ELC) to regulate voltage and frequency of single-phase self-excited induction generator (SEIG) for constant power applications such as uncontrolled turbine in pico hydro power generation. An electronic load controller is developed for maintaining constant voltage and frequency of SEIG with variable consumer loads driven by uncontrolled water turbine. The transient behavior of SEIG-ELC system at different operating conditions such as application and removal of resistive and reactive (0.8 PF) loads and starting of a single-phase induction motor as dynamic load is investigated to demonstrate the capability of proposed ELC. Extensive tests are conducted on the developed prototype of SEIG-ELC system
